Exploration on Solid Waste Resource Utilization Path in Building Material Industry Supported by PC Brick Making Equipment

        PC brick making machine, fully named precast concrete brick forming equipment, is special forming equipment for manufacturing concrete products used in municipal pavement construction. Its production follows the industrial standards for block forming machines specified in JC/T920-2011. It can produce imitation stone bricks, water-permeable bricks, tactile paving bricks, curb stones, grass planting bricks and other pavement building materials. The complete set of equipment consists of a batching and mixing unit, layered distributing mechanism, hydraulic forming main unit, automatic plate feeding and demoulding assembly and electric control system. The whole production process includes five steps: raw material proportioning and mixing, layered material distribution, static pressure vibration compaction, green brick demoulding and transfer curing. Green bricks are formed through physical compression under normal temperature without high-temperature sintering procedures.
        The equipment supports a wide range of raw materials. Sand, stone and stone powder are adopted as base materials. During production, fly ash, steel slag, recycled aggregate from construction waste and other industrial and construction waste can be mixed in reasonable proportions. Materials are evenly stirred and then sent into molds for forming. After inspection, mechanical indicators of finished products meet relevant specifications for municipal pavement building materials, which can satisfy the usage requirements of paving projects including urban roads, landscape sites and public buildings. By adopting such raw material collocation schemes, building material manufacturers can consume local stock solid waste and adjust raw material procurement structures, which conforms to relevant policy guidance on harmless disposal of solid waste in various regions.
        According to the moisture content of materials during forming, machine models available on the market are divided into three forming processes: dry method, wet method and mixed dry-wet method. Dry forming equipment features stable energy consumption control and balanced water permeability of finished products, suitable for community walkways and ordinary municipal sidewalks. Wet forming equipment delivers stable pressure output and complete surface textures of bricks, applicable to venues with high decorative demands such as commercial plazas and high-speed railway platforms. The mixed dry-wet forming method integrates characteristics of the former two processes, balancing surface appearance and bottom water permeability, and is widely adopted in production lines supporting garden and comprehensive road projects. The equipment is fitted with combined molds. Operators can replace molds of different specifications according to orders to realize the production of various products. Standardized production lines only require a small number of on-duty staff, suitable for regular continuous operation of small and medium-sized building material processing plants.
        In terms of structural design, mainstream PC brick making machines adopt an integrated electromechanical-hydraulic solution. The frame is a section steel welded structure, adapting to long-term working conditions with continuous pressure and vibration. Separate bins are set for base materials and surface materials, and the two types of raw materials are conveyed and fed independently to reduce deviations in specification and weight of single finished bricks. The hydraulic oil circuit is equipped with a pressure stabilizing structure. Pressure is released uniformly after forming to lower the probability of defective bricks with chipped edges or cracks. The electric control system is equipped with program interlock logic, enabling automatic coordination of each working procedure and mitigating production fluctuations caused by manual operation.
        Daily operation and maintenance can be divided into three stages: pre-shift inspection, in-production patrol inspection and post-shift maintenance. Before production, staff need to check the hydraulic oil level, motor circuits and fastening status of molds, and clear agglomerated raw materials in bins to prevent feeding blockage. During production, operating parameters such as oil pressure and material distribution uniformity should be recorded regularly, and production shall be suspended for inspection in case of abnormal parameters. After daily production, residual materials on the whole equipment need to be thoroughly cleaned. Lubricating grease should be applied to moving parts including sliding rails and guide columns. Wearing parts such as hydraulic filter elements and sealing pieces shall be replaced in accordance with operation cycles. Enterprises can establish operation and maintenance ledgers to record component replacement and fault maintenance information, arrange quarterly in-depth maintenance based on cumulative equipment operation hours, stabilize continuous production efficiency and extend the service life of the whole machine.
        With the continuous advancement of sponge city construction and tighter control over natural stone mining, market demand for pavement building materials made from recycled raw materials maintains steady growth, and the quantity of supporting PC brick production lines rises gradually. Many building material industrial parks are equipped with pre-treatment equipment for crushing and screening solid waste, building a circular industrial chain covering waste recovery, proportioning and brick making, and supply of finished products to infrastructure projects. Such production modes are continuously popularized among small and medium-sized processing enterprises in counties, promoting steady low-carbon and resource-oriented development in the building material manufacturing sector.
